● Fixing receiver to carbon chassis
When fixing the receiver to the chassis or on the mechanism
deck, use more than 2 layers of doublesided tape to avoid
direct contact with chassis. Chassis and mechanism deck
(especially carbon material) can also conduct noise. Making
space between receiver with them is recommend to ensure
protection against noise.
Note receiver LED position when installing.
● Antenna installation
Raise antenna cable vertically and set as high as possible. Pass cable into antenna pipe to protect from damage. Be sure
that the cable projects a bit from antenna pipe. Installing antenna holder far away from receiver may deteriorate radio
sensitivity. Locate antenna holder as near to the receiver as possible. Make sure that the antenna cable does not come in
direct contact with chassis, mechanism plate or other noise sources. Make sure to use plastic antenna pipe and mount. Do
not use metal antenna mount as it easily conducts noise and result in trouble.

● Attaching to a gas car
Engine vibration may damage the servo. Make sure to attach
grommet (receiver holder) to reduce vibration. Do not attach
directly to chassis or mechanism plate using double-sided tape.
The installation position should be as far as possible from heat
from engine or exhaust.
Note receiver LED position when installing.
